Legal Consequences: Creating or using a false identification document is punishable by law in Mexico. Official institutions only recognize IDs issued directly by the INE. 3. How to Officially Update Your INE
If your goal is to "update" your actual voter ID information, you should never use a PDF template. Instead, follow the official procedure through the INE's official portal:
Schedule an Appointment: Visit the official INE Appointment System to find your nearest module. Required Documents: Bring three original documents: Assuming you have a legitimate, watermarked template for
Proof of Nationality: Birth certificate or naturalization letter. Photo ID: A previous INE, passport, or driver's license.
Proof of Address: A utility bill (water, electricity, or telephone) not older than three months.
Digital Processing: The INE will take your photo, fingerprints, and digital signature on-site.
Collection: You will receive a receipt to pick up your high-security, official card a few days later. 4. Digital Alternatives
For those looking for a digital version of their ID for verification purposes, the INE offers the INE México app, which allows you to generate a digital QR code for identity verification without needing to edit a PDF manually.

Verification Systems: Modern institutions use real-time database verification (e.g., checking against the official INE Lista Nominal) and biometric facial recognition to detect fake IDs instantly. 2. Official Methods to Obtain or Update an INE
To ensure you have a valid and legal identification, follow the official procedures provided by the Instituto Nacional Electoral (INE):
Domestic Registration: If you are in Mexico, you must visit an official INE module with a birth certificate, photo ID, and proof of address.
Voting from Abroad: Mexican citizens living abroad can process their credential at the nearest Mexican Consulate or Embassy.
